3

簡単な質問があります。現在、Analytics でクロス ドメイン トラッキングを行っている場合、URL にはトラッキング用のパラメータが追加されています。POST などの方法を使用して 1 つのドメインから次のドメインに Cookie 情報を渡す方法があるので、すべての URL パラメーターが追加されても URL が乱雑にならないようにする方法はあるのでしょうか。

たとえば、google.com から yahoo.com/lots_of_paramters に移動する場合、yahoo.com/gclid=123 だけに移動できますか

乾杯、ゆり

4

1 に答える 1

0

パラメータは他のドメインで読み取られ、同じ Google アナリティクス Cookie が再作成されます。

POST で送信されたデータは、バックエンドでのみ Javascript を介して投稿されたページでは使用できません。したがって、このデータを実際に保存してインターフェイスに送り返すには、バックエンドが必要です。おそらく AJAX を介して、そこで Cookie を再作成します。

もう 1 つのアイデアは、サーバー側の Cookie を解析して新しい Cookie として送信することです。これにより、宛先ドメインの Javascript コードで Cookie を再作成する必要がなくなり、通常の HTTP ヘッダー セットの Cookie になります。

それでも、Cookie を渡すだけでも大変な作業と混乱が生じます。URL は醜いですが、それでも問題を処理する最も簡単で移植可能な方法です。

于 2013-03-27T23:09:38.047 に答える